Analysis

Oberfranken recorded 306,850 Hectare for beneficiary of rural development support measures by age, sex and in 2023. That is the highest value across all 5 years on record.

That represents a change of up 6.9% on the previous year and up 2.7% over ten years.

Over the whole period, beneficiary of rural development support measures by age, sex and in Oberfranken peaked at 306,850 Hectare in 2023 and was at its lowest, 287,040 Hectare, in 2020.

That places Oberfranken 63rd out of 124 regions with data for 2023, putting it in the middle of the range.
